Should You Buy a 2011 Suzuki DR-Z400EK?

The 2011 Suzuki DR-Z400EK is a versatile dual-sport motorcycle that offers a blend of off-road capability and on-road comfort. With its lightweight design and agile handling, it is suitable for both novice and experienced riders looking for a reliable bike for various terrains. The DR-Z400EK is powered by a 398cc engine, providing enough torque and horsepower for spirited rides while maintaining fuel efficiency. Although specific MPG and MSRP data are not available, the bike is known for its affordability and low maintenance costs, making it an attractive option for budget-conscious riders.

This motorcycle is ideal for those who enjoy weekend adventures, commuting, or exploring trails. Its robust build and suspension system allow for a smooth ride over rough surfaces, while the comfortable seating position ensures long-distance comfort. Riders looking for a dependable and fun motorcycle that can handle both city streets and off-road paths will find the DR-Z400EK to be a solid choice.
